Titus lives in a nearfuture version of america, where science has advanced far enough to allow touristy space travel and about 70% of the population has what is called the feed, an advanced form of the internet combined with every social networking site you can possibly imagineall implanted directly into peoples heads. At its core, beloved is a novel about a mother and her children, centered around the relationship between sethe and the unnamed daughter she kills, as well as the strange rebirth of that daughter in the form of beloved.
